Do not talk to the Insurance Company

It's natural to want to explain your side of the story to the insurance company when they call. This is a huge mistake. Insurance companies aren't your benefactors; they're there to make sure you get the lowest amount they can. Insurance agents will speak with you for as long as possible in the hope that you'll give them something to use against your claim or blame you for it.

Make sure that you keep your discussion focused on the facts of the accident. Don't speculate, or make assumptions about what transpired during the accident. This could be a problem in your case. Insurance representatives will be monitoring your case to find any snippets of information that they could use to either deny your claim or decrease the amount you're awarded.

Don't sign any written or recorded statement from the insurance company of the other driver. This is a common tactic to force you to admit to something that could be used against you in settlement negotiations. It's best not to give these statements and to inquire with your attorney instead.

Your attorney can handle any conversations with the insurance company on your behalf, ensuring that you do not have to make any compromising statements. Your attorney can provide the other party's insurer with your medical records to help them comprehend the extent of the injuries and damages you've suffered.

Don't Admit Fault

It's tempting to blame an accident or admit to fault when you see the other driver upset and angry. But, it's important to not give in to these temptations and avoid making any remarks that could be used against you later on. Even if you're correct admitting your fault could hurt your case and make it more difficult to get the compensation that you deserve.

In addition to not admitting guilt at the scene of an accident, you should avoid discussing the incident with other drivers or anyone else involved. It's acceptable to exchange information like name or phone numbers as well as insurance coverage with the other driver, but do not engage in any discussion about what happened or who is at fault. It's also important to report the accident to the police to ensure a complete and accurate police report can be prepared.

You should not make any statements at the scene of the accident. They could be used in court against you. It is better to wait until you have spoken with an attorney. Insurance companies and lawyers with financial stakes in the crash will attempt to portray you as the driver at fault which could damage your claim and increase the liability that you have to pay.

You can aid your case by being transparent and honest about the accident to your lawyer and other parties involved. Take pictures of the accident site, including any visible damage. This will give you valuable evidence that can be used to prove your account of the incident.

Do not accept the initial settlement offer

If you've filed a car accident claim with an insurance company, you may receive an offer to settle. The offer is likely to originate from an adjuster within the insurance company, and is usually very low. It is best to refuse the initial offer and have your lawyer negotiate a more affordable amount.

Keep in mind that insurance companies exist to make money, so they will try to give you the lowest amount they can. It is crucial to have an attorney to your side. Your lawyer will even the playing field and have a clear understanding of what your claim is worth, which is crucial when it comes to negotiations with an insurance adjuster.

Insurance companies are aware that you are desperate to get a check. This is why the initial settlement offer will be so low. They also know that you face increasing medical expenses and lost income due to being unable work because of your injuries. This is why it is important to take the time to calculate the total cost of your medical expenses as well as non-economic damages, such as pain and suffering, and add them to your demand letter.

It could take months or even years to fully heal and understand how your injuries can impact your life in the future. Accepting a settlement also means that you are giving up the right to sue in the future for additional compensation.

The rejection of the initial settlement offer is one of the best actions you can take to protect yourself from a car accident. You should be ready to accept a counter-offer by the insurance company. If the insurance company does not increase their offer then you might want to think about filing a lawsuit to claim personal injury.
